> >However, we can't login to the admin webpage. After we input password,
> >the page was loading as shown in the status bar, but after several
> >minutes still can't show the admin page and finally it said "page can't
> >be loaded".
>
Seems like the list may be locked. If so, and the lock is stale, you
can manually remove the lock from Mailman's locks/ directory, but
first be sure it isn't locked by some current process.
Sounds to me like the server is just too busy for the web to respond
before the browser time-out. I used to get this all the time on my
100K-500K member list sendings. If a message was still being
sent/processed, the web site would not respond, or would respond very
slowly. It is generally the case that servers consider other task,
including smtp, a higher priority than http requests. This can cause
http requests to time out if the server resources are otherwise occupied.
